Will I be unconscious or will I remember my birth experience?
Hypnobirthing

Despite misconceptions and misinformation, you are definitely not unconscious during self-hypnosis. The HypnoBirthing® mother is deeply relaxed, but she is also an active participant in the labor process.  Though she is deeply relaxed, she is totally aware and may return to a conversant state or choose to become mobile whenever she desires. HypnoBirthing® mothers often find that they are so relaxed that they are not distracted by other people or their birthing environment, while they focus on their birthing and their baby
